NettetIn statistics, Deming regression, named after W. Edwards Deming, is an errors-in-variables model which tries to find the line of best fit for a two-dimensional dataset. It differs from the simple linear regression in that it accounts for errors in observations on both the x - and the y - axis. It is a special case of total least squares, which ... Learn more about partial least squares, regression Statistics and Machine Learning Toolbox NettetStatisticians refer to squared residuals as squared errors and their total as the sum of squared errors (SSE), shown below mathematically. SSE = Σ (y – ŷ)². Σ represents a sum. In this case, it’s the sum of all residuals squared. You’ll see a lot of sums in the least squares line formula section! NettetStatistical fluctuations in counting rates etc., as well as defects in the structural model, can introduce bias in the estimation of parameters by least-squares refinements. Of the residuaIs in common use, only unweighted R2 = Σ(Io - Ic)2 is free from statistical bias.
